Not only will Charles Schwab send you a debit card when you open a Schwab Bank High Yield Investor Savings® Account, but the bank reimburses 100% of ATM fees charged by ATM operators. The bank will not charge a foreign transaction fee if you use this debit card abroad.

How long does it take for Charles Schwab to reimburse ATM fees?

You will receive a Schwab Bank Visa® Platinum Debit Card that can be used for purchases anywhere Visa is accepted and provides you with unlimited ATM fee rebates within 7-10 business days after funding your account.

How much can I withdraw from an ATM Charles Schwab?

The Charles Schwab daily ATM withdrawal limit is $1,000 per day. Withdrawals at other Network ATMs may require authorization from Charles Schwab. The bank may limit the number of authorizations in a day. In this case, you need to contact the bank at 1-888-403-9000 to sort out any emerging issues.

How do I transfer money from Charles Schwab to my bank?

After logging in select Accounts, then Transfers & Payments. Choose Online Transfer (or Check Request if applicable), then Setup, Cash Only and choose your accounts. Note that you can use this portal to move cash to your bank account from your Schwab account, or to your Schwab account from your bank account.

What fees does Charles Schwab charge?

Online listed stock and ETF trades at Schwab are commission-free. Online options trades are $0.65 per contract. Service charges apply for automated phone trades ($5) and broker-assisted trades ($25) for stocks, ETFs, and Options. Futures trades are $2.25 per contract8 for both online and broker-assisted trades.
